Output 6aeda6834dc0ba130d902e4a2fea5c9a36e7d0673c49f0b6773915e27e9d7f4a:41

value
377928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64abacd09273e9246e18f2d090374bae66ee53a2 OP_EQUAL
address
3AsK9vFU3jmL46oRbBAhxtHQHVfdenUGzf
transaction
6aeda6834dc0ba130d902e4a2fea5c9a36e7d0673c49f0b6773915e27e9d7f4a
spent
true